Abstract

PURPOSE: To prevent decrease of sealing pressure even if a sealing element is deteriorated and worn due to the lapse of time by arranging a spring device which pushes an annular elastic material sealing element which contacts with the outer circumference of a linear sliding shaft which requires high degree of sealing.
CONSTITUTION: A circumferential groove 3 is formed on the shaft sliding surface of the supporting element 1 which supports a sliding shaft 2, and an annular sealing element 4 is installed into the circumferential groove 3, and with said sealing element 4, one end of a compression spring 7 is contacted under pressure through a pressing plate 6, and the other end is supported by a spring receiving element 8 fixed on the supporting element 1. Therefore, even if the sealing element 4 is deteriorated and worn, and the elastic force is reduced, a constant pressure is applied by the compression spring 7, and sealing action is not reduced, and reliability is improved.
